The symptoms of body aches and pains after waking up: 1. It may be due to overexertion on the first day, or sleeping with a cold at night, or lack of physical exercise, suddenly engaging in heavy physical labor or strenuous sports activities, causing the body to be temporarily in a state of oxygen deprivation and anaerobic enzymolysis, thus producing a large amount of lactic acid accumulation in the body, slow metabolism, causing the symptoms of muscle aches and pains throughout the body. 2. Due to decreased resistance or cold after sleeping, upper respiratory tract infections, such as viral colds, patients may have fever and generalized aches and pains in addition to the symptoms of a cold. In this case, you should pay attention to rest, avoid straining, avoid strenuous activities, pay attention to protection from cold and warmth, and give oral medication to relieve symptoms of cold and symptomatic treatment. Therefore, if the symptoms of body aches and pains appear after sleeping, active symptomatic treatment should be given after the cause is clear, and if there is no relief within a short period of time, you must go to a regular hospital in time.
